Subject: Key rotation — GarageGlance occupancy feed

For the weekly eng sync: we rotated the API key that the GarageGlance dashboard uses to pull stall-occupancy counts from the internal sensor-aggregate service. The old key is revoked as of this morning; any consumer still on it will see 401s. Downstream teams (signage, capacity forecasts) have been updated. Action item: update your local dev configs before Monday's demo. The new key for the sensor-aggregate service is below.

API key for tagef-fafop: vxb2-ta

Runbook: Query planner regression (Saltmarsh DB)

If customers report slow dashboard loads after the Saltmarsh 4.2 upgrade, it's probably the planner picking a nested loop over the hash join. Quick fix: toggle the planner hint flag and restart the query node. Before escalating, grab the plan output and note the trace token below.

pipeline stamp: htk31_f769b577b3028a4e9958e5bb8d1259a

WIKI (Managers Only) — Customer-Concentration Risk

Audience: Sales Leads

One account, Bexworth Logistics, now represents 41% of Arlen Dynamics revenue. Threshold policy caps single-customer exposure at 30%. Actions: no further discounting to Bexworth; prioritize pipeline in the Calder region; report weekly on diversification progress. Contract renewal lands in Q3 — treat as at-risk. Escalate any Bexworth churn signals same day. Mitigation strategy and targets are outlined below.

board note of kageg-bahof: The renewal with Holwynax Holdings closes at $2 million a year, 5 percent below the last contract. Project Ulaath slips by two quarters because of the supplier delay.